Audio Interface question
Hello,
I'd like to know the best low-cost ($150-250) audio interface option to use for my PTs 10HD (10.3.5) setup. I just need 2 inputs (line & mic), nothing elaborate. I have a Mac Pro 5.1 2010, 6-Core, OSX 10.9.5, ATI Radeon HD 5770 card, 16G Ram. The Apogee Rosetta 200 Converter has been suggested, especially for a step up in recording quality & plugging it directly using the Mac's rear Optical ports, I just want to ask some of the experts on this forum since I have been assisted here in the past. I tried hooking up an Mbox2 Pro, but couldn't get PTs to recognize it, even tho' it was showing up in the firewire listing & my ILok was showing up in the USB listing in the System Report. After uninstalling & re-installing the drivers, trashing prefs, etc, I later found out my particular MBox2 Pro is not compatible with PTs 10 HD. Any help would be greatly appreciated~! |

Re: Audio Interface question
Just to throw another one out there, I’m a fan of PreSonus interfaces. Something like their Studio 24c would do the trick. Their XMAX preamps are quite good for that price range and their drivers are solid.
